Abstract

The invention discloses a digital signature method, system and terminal based on a mobile phone card, and relates to the technical field of communication. The method of the present invention includes: the terminal receives the information to be signed sent by the application platform; the terminal forwards the information to be signed to the mobile phone card through the BIP channel; the terminal receives the digitally signed information sent by the mobile phone card through the BIP channel; The signed information is returned to the application platform for signature verification. The present invention establishes a BIP channel between the terminal and the mobile phone card, and based on the BIP channel, the mobile phone card and the application platform establish an interactive channel through the terminal, which can realize the digital signature based on the mobile phone card and provide security for the transmission of information. At the same time, the present invention The solution is applicable to a variety of terminals. It is simple and convenient, and there will be no problems of missed sending and long delay in the SMS mode, and the user experience will be improved.

Description

technical field [0001] The invention relates to the technical field of communication, in particular to a digital signature method, system and terminal based on a mobile phone card. Background technique [0002] Mobile phone cards, such as SIM (Subscriber Identification Module, customer identification module) cards or UIM (User Identify Module, user identification module) cards have secure data storage capabilities. Based on this feature, mobile phone cards are currently widely used in the field of security authentication, such as , authenticate the identity of the user when transferring money through mobile banking, use the mobile phone card to perform digital signatures, etc. [0003] At present, the interaction between the mobile phone card and the application server usually uses the following methods: OMA (Open Mobile API, mobile open interface) and OTA (Over the Air, over-the-air technology) short message method.
